[quote]The Lamar University football team will play a game-like scrimmage Nov. 9 at the school's soccer field, the university announced Thursday.

Kickoff is 7 p.m. at the Lamar Soccer Complex. Admission is free.

The scrimmage will end the team's fall practices in preparation for the return of football for the 2010 season, the school's first since 1989.

"We're going to make this thing as close to a game experience as we can for the players, the coaches, the students and the fans," LU coach Ray Woodard said.

The scrimmage will follow an offense-vs.-defense format, with a scoring system devised to reward the defense with points in ways other than touchdowns and safeties. The alternate scoring system is necessary because LU does not have enough players to fill two separate squads at all positions.[/quote]
